CURLOPT_TELNETOPTIONS - Man Page

set of telnet options

Synopsis

#include <curl/curl.h>

CURLcode curl_easy_setopt(CURL *handle, CURLOPT_TELNETOPTIONS,
                          struct curl_slist *cmds);

Description

Provide a pointer to a curl_slist with variables to pass to the telnet negotiations. The variables should be in the format <option=value>. libcurl supports the options TTYPE, XDISPLOC and NEW_ENV. See the TELNET standard for details.

Default

NULL

Protocols

TELNET

Example

CURL *curl = curl_easy_init();
if(curl) {
  struct curl_slist *options;
  options = curl_slist_append(NULL, "TTTYPE=vt100");
  options = curl_slist_append(options, "USER=foobar");
  curl_easy_setopt(curl, CURLOPT_URL, "telnet://example.com/");
  curl_easy_setopt(curl, CURLOPT_TELNETOPTIONS, options);
  ret = curl_easy_perform(curl);
  curl_easy_cleanup(curl);
  curl_slist_free_all(options);
}

Availability

Along with TELNET

Return Value

Returns CURLE_OK if TELNET is supported, and CURLE_UNKNOWN_OPTION if not.
